The evolution of the "Avast key" also mirrors the broader shift in the software industry toward subscription-based models. Historically, users purchased a perpetual license key that would last for the lifetime of a specific version. Today, Avast, like many competitors, has largely transitioned to annual subscription models. This shift changes the nature of the key from a one-time purchase to a renewable service agreement. This model ensures that the user is not just buying a static tool, but subscribing to a constantly updating defense network that responds to new threats in real-time.
